About Amber Yarmuch

Amber Yarmuch serves as the Children and Family Services Senior Manager at the Métis Nation of Alberta, where she has worked since 2020. She holds a Bachelor of Social Work from the University of Victoria and has extensive experience in social work and community support.

Work at Métis Nation of Alberta

Amber Yarmuch has been employed at Métis Nation of Alberta since 2017. She has held multiple roles, including Métis Resource Worker and Children Services Manager. Since 2020, she has served as the Children and Family Services Senior Manager. In these positions, she has contributed to the development and implementation of programs aimed at supporting children and families within the Métis community in Edmonton, Alberta.

Education and Expertise

Amber Yarmuch studied at the University of Victoria, where she earned a Bachelor of Social Work (BSW) from 2015 to 2018. Prior to that, she attended MacEwan University, obtaining a Social Work diploma from 2012 to 2014. Her educational background has equipped her with the knowledge and skills necessary for her roles in social work and community support.

Background

Amber Yarmuch began her career in social services as a Community Support Worker at Wics from 2014 to 2017 in Sherwood Park, Alberta. This role provided her with foundational experience in supporting individuals and families in need. Her subsequent positions at Métis Nation of Alberta have allowed her to focus on the specific needs of the Métis community.
